Positional Profile: OF/LHP
Body: 6-2, 195 pounds. Long levers, athletic build, will add.
Hit: LHH. Upright, rhythmic leg tuck, lands with controlled crash to centered hitting position. Flat swing, intent to do damage, whip and length through the zone. 74.5 mph bat speed with 13g of rotational acceleration.
Power: 104 mph max exit velocity (90.6 avg.); 262-foot max batted distance.
Arm: LH. OF - 85 mph. 3/4 slot, power to it with carry and accuracy.
Defense: Attacks the baseball, intentful one-handed gather with timing and aggression through the baseball.
Athletic Testing: 7.30 runner in the 60-yard dash; 21.50-inch max vertical jump.
Vizual Edge: 51.42 Edge Score.
Delivery: Stretch only, medium knee lift, stays linear, clean, rhythm.
Arm Action: LH. Clean action, athletic, full arm circle, 3/4 slot.
FB: T83, 81-82 mph. Feel, works around the zone, mostly straight with natural run. T1996, 1932 average rpm.
CB: 71-74 mph. Tight spin, works in the zone. T1754, 1700 average rpm.
CH: 69-71 mph. Natural run, developing feel. T1735, 1608 average rpm.
OF Nolan Hecht (DePaul College Prep, 2028) put on a show in his round of BP, and he will be a real power bat to monitor in the coming years. Standing in at 6-foot-2, 180-pounds, there’s some lean strength in his frame at the moment, but there is also still room for him to add in the coming years. At the plate, the left-handed hitter has a longer, flat swing with easy jump off the barrel, peaking at 104 mph for his EV with line-drives, also averaging 74.4 mph for his bat-speed. He showed steady, reliable actions in the outfield, pairing with a strong arm (T85 mph). On the mound, the southpaw showed a clean delivery with a three-pitch mix. The fastball ran up to 83 mph with natural run, and he showed two offspeed offerings with a changeup and curveball mix for strikes.
Hecht presents an intriguing 6-foot-1, 170 pound frame with room to fill out. Hecht helped offensively with the win over Longshots Baseball going 3-for-3 with three RBI’s. He has a simple left-handed approach, looking to drive balls into the gaps. He showcased that he can hit balls to all parts of the field. Mechanically, he has a balanced load with a short stride, the barrel stays flat through the zone, and has direct hands to the ball. There is a lot of upside for Hecht with growth and development in the future.
1B/LHP Nolan Hecht (N/A, 2028) is a left/left two-way prospect to note from the event. Offensively, short, simple swing, repeated line-drive contact with loose, strong hands and the top exit velocity of the event; T81 mph. He was also comfortable around the first base bag during defense, showing athleticism and a loose arm that was good for the second-strongest of the event at 71 mph. He rounded out his day on the mound where he sat 70-71 mph.
Positional Profile: 1B
Body: 6-0, 160-pounds. Well-proportioned frame.
Hit: LHH. Balanced setup, minimal hands load, small leg-lift stride. Loose hands with strength. Short and simple swing, level path, line drive approach. Repeats.
Power: 81 max exit velocity, averaged 72 mph. 272’ max distance.
Arm: LH. INF - 71 mph. Loose arm action, 3/4 slot.
Defense: Comfortable actions around the bag, glove-pat transfer to throw.
Run: 8.21 runner in the 60.
Positional Profile: LHP
Delivery: Simple, easy delivery, medium leg lift with coil, drop/drive delivery.
Arm Action: LH. Loose arm action, high 3/4 slot.
FB: T72, 71-72 mph. Natural arm-side run. T2091, 1992 average rpm.
CB: 69-71 mph. 12/6 shaped, plays low in the zone. T1857, 1685 average rpm.
CH: 67-68 mph. Downer action, used two different grips. T1677, 1608 average rpm.
